CHEBI:64266 - tricyclene

ChEBI IDCHEBI:64266
ChEBI Nametricyclene
Stars
DefinitionA monoterpene that is tricyclo[2.2.1.02,6]heptane bearing a three additional methyl substituents (one at position 1 and two at position 7).

FormulaC10H16
Net Charge0
Average Mass136.238
Monoisotopic Mass136.12520
SMILESCC1(C)C2CC3C(C2)C31C
InChIInChI=1S/C10H16/c1-9(2)6-4-7-8(5-6)10(7,9)3/h6-8H,4-5H2,1-3H3
InChIKeyRRBYUSWBLVXTQN-UHFFFAOYSA-N
